§ B · Regulatory

Licensing Requirements

NJ
§1

Licensing Requirements

NJ does not require a general handyman license, but specific trades require licensing: electrical work needs Electrical Contractor License, plumbing requires Master Plumber License. Business registration and construction permits may be required for jobs over $200. Major renovations require Home Improvement Contractor registration.

§2

Permit Requirements

Trenton requires permits for electrical, plumbing, and structural work. Minor repairs under $200 typically exempt. Building permits required through City of Trenton Construction Code Office for jobs involving structural changes.

§3

Inspection Schedule

Inspections required for permitted work only - electrical rough/final, plumbing rough/final, building final. Most handyman work falls below inspection thresholds.

§4

Insurance Minimums

General liability minimum $300,000 recommended, workers compensation required if employing others. Bonding requirements vary by job scope and client requirements.

§ C · Path to license

How to Get Licensed

5 STEPS
1

Determine scope of work

Identify which services you'll offer. General handyman work requires no license, but electrical, plumbing, and HVAC work requires specific trade licensing.

01/05
2

Register business entity

Register business with NJ Division of Revenue through NJ Business Registration portal. Obtain federal EIN from IRS.

02/05
3

Obtain trade licenses if applicable

For electrical work, apply for Electrical Contractor License through NJ Board of Examiners of Electrical Contractors. For plumbing, obtain Master Plumber License through State Board of Master Plumbers.

03/05
4

Secure required insurance

Purchase general liability insurance minimum $300,000. Obtain workers compensation if employing others. Consider bonding for larger projects.

04/05
5

Register with local authorities

Register business with Trenton tax office. Familiarize yourself with local permit requirements through Construction Code Office.

§ D · Field notes

About This Market

UPDATED APR 2026

Trenton's handyman market runs hot with steady residential repair demand across diverse housing stock - everything from century-old row homes to newer developments. Competition's fierce with nearly 4,000 licensed establishments statewide, but good operators stay busy with repeat customers. Jobs typically run $150-800, driven by material costs, job complexity, and contractor experience. The aging housing stock means constant work in plumbing fixes, drywall repairs, and maintenance calls.

To work this market, know that NJ doesn't license general handymen, but step into electrical or plumbing territory and you need proper credentials fast. Trenton's building department runs tight ship on permits - anything structural or involving systems needs paperwork. Peak season hits April through September for exterior work, but interior repairs keep you busy year-round. Build your reputation through quality work and referrals - that's what separates the pros from the weekend warriors in this competitive market.
